You'll have to solve simultaneously
let nickel be x, dime be y
x + y = 35 ... ( 1 )
5x + 10 y = 250
5 ( x + 2y ) = 250
x + 2y = 50 ... ( 2 )
in ( 1 )
x = 35 - y ( 3 )
sub ( 3 ) into ( 2 )
( 35 - y ) + 2y = 50
y = 15
sub y into ( 1 )
x + y = 35
x + 15 = 35
x = 20
therefore, Sandy has 20 nickels and 15 dimes

Slope-intercept form:
y = mx + b
"m" is the slope, "b" is the y-intercept (the y value when x = 0) or (0,y)
To find "m", you can use the slope formula and plug in the two points:
(2,3) = (x₁ , y₁)
(0,9) = (x₂ , y₂)



m = -3
y = -3x + b
To find "b", you can plug in one of the points into the equation (however they already gave you the y-intercept (0,9) or 9)
(2,3)
y = -3x + b
3 = -3(2) + b
3 = -6 + b
9 = b
y = -3x + 9
